**POSITION BACKGROUND**:
The HR Manager acts as the primary liaison between the leadership group and the organization regarding HR functions, objectives, and processes. The HR Manager is expected to take strategic measures to improve the quality of HR for Ketek Group Inc.

**CORE DUTIES**:
**Organizational Effectiveness**
- Plans and manages the Human Resource (HR) aspects of organizational change
- Collaborates with senior leadership to roll-out changes to organizational structure, human resources practices, or changes to legislation
- Consistently works to improve existing programs for employee discounts, recognition

**Employee Relations**
- Implements and evaluates Ketek’s employee relations and human resources policies, programs, and practices
- Provides safe space for employees to reach out about issues with coworkers, supervisor, or at home, and provides additional resources as appropriate
- Coaches and mentors supervisors and managers on the progressive discipline process Compensation and Benefits
- Evaluates the total compensation strategy to ensure it is consistent with the objectives of attracting, motivating, and retaining qualified people
- Manages the transition to new benefit plans and ensure their effectiveness and efficiency of benefit programs
- Works with management to update job requirements and job descriptions for all positions
- Works with senior management during bi-annual compensation review
- Ensures legal compliance by monitoring and implementing applicable human resource legislation, conducting investigations, and maintaining records as directed by FOIP legislation

**Other Duties**
- Cultivates professional and technical knowledge by attending educational workshops, reviewing professional publications, and establishing personal networks
- Manages human resources and training staff by recruiting, selecting, orienting, and training employees
- Represent Ketek in a light that is commensurate with the values of Management and the Corporate Vision and Mission Statements

**QUALIFICATIONS AND SKILLS**:
**Required**
- Post-secondary education in Human Resources Management
- Minimum 7 years’ experience in Human Resources
- Fluent in the English language (reading, written, spoken)
- Ability to handle multiple tasks and frequent demanding deadlines while working individually or as part of a team
- Be proactive, self-motivated, and self-directed
- Strong computer skills (Microsoft Office)
- Able to deal with the public in a positive, courteous, and respectful manner
- Effectively handle changing schedules and priorities, with high level prioritization skills
- Strong work ethic and organizational planning skills with attention to detail
- Able to work independently or as part of a team
- Effective verbal and listening communication skills
- Able to handle confidential information appropriately

**Preferred**
- Experience with Human Rights Legislation for each of the western Canadian Provinces
- Experience with Employment Standards for each of the western Canadian Provinces
- Certified Professional in Human Resources (CPHR)
- Knowledge of Occupational Health and Safety legislation
- Knowledge of adult instructional and learning theory and principles, instructional design, training methodologies, learning management systems and competency assessment
